We investigated the quality indices of the biomass from common oat Avena sativa, romanian cultivar 'Sorin' which was grown in the experimental plot of the ``Alexandru Ciubotaru'' National Botanical Garden (Institute), Chisinau, Republic of Moldova. The results revealed that the dry matter of whole oat plants contained 9.5% CP with forage value 598 g/kg DDM, RFV= 89, 11.84 MJ/kg DE, 9.72 MJ/kg ME and 5.37 MJ/kg NEl; prepared oat hay contained 10.5% CP, 574 g/kg DDM, 11.40 MJ/kg DE, 9.36 MJ/kg ME and 5.39 MJ/kg NEl. The oat haylage is characterized by pH = 3.77, 38.1 g/kg lactic acid, 5.9 g/kg acetic acid, 10.2% CP, 567-619 g/kg DDM, 11.28 MJ/kg DE, 9.26 MJ/kg ME and 5.29 MJ/kg NEl. The biochemical methane potential of the studied substrates from Avena sativa cv. 'Sorin' reaches 329-355 l/kg VS.
